Emma May Griggs, 84, Native of Area, Passes
Emma May Griggs, a lifetime resident of the Crabtree-Scio communities passed away July 5th at 2 a.m. at the Mary Ellen Nursing Home in Lebanon at the age of 84 years, 1 month and 17 days.
She was born May 18, 1868 to the late Jim and Linda [Malinda] Compton at Scio, near the Richardson Gap Community. At the age of 14 she joined the Baptist church at Providence.
In 1888 she was married to Henry Kinzer of Crabtree, who passed away in 1919. To this union, three sons, Ray, Jim and Cleo were born. Mrs. Kinzer later married Charley Griggs of Salem, Oregon in 1922. He preceded her in death in 1933.
In 1944 she became a member of the Crabtree Christian Church and was also a member of the Evening Star Grange at Crabtree.
Mrs. Griggs is survived by her three sons, Roy Kinzer, Lebanon; Jim and Cleo Kinzer, both of Brookings, Oregon; two stepsons, Clyde and Harold Griggs of Portland and two stepdaughters, Helen of Salem and Edna of Portland. Also surviving are 10 grandchildren and 16 great-grandchildren.
Funeral services were held Tuesday afternoon, July 8th at the Huston Funeral Home in Lebanon with Rev. Ivan Cordell, past of the First Christian Church of Lebanon officiating and Mrs. Virginia McKinney as vocalist accompanied by Mrs. Joel C. Booth at the organ. Interment was in Franklin Butte cemetery near Scio with Don Kennedy, Lee Jones, Arch and Lloyd Miller, John Sumpter and Larry Gorman serving as pall bearers.
